WebHow many volcanoes erupted in the Philippines? The list below showing 27 active volcanoes in the Philippines was based on the PHIVOLCS list with some included from the GVP. The number is not definite and depends on someone's definition of "active" or historical time frame. Descriptions under "eruptions" were based on the GVP website. WebThis is a List of inactive volcanoes in the Philippines.Volcanoes with no record of eruptions are considered as extinct or inactive. Their physical form since their last activity has been altered by agents of weathering and erosion with the formation of deep and long gullies. Inactive does not necessarily indicate the volcano will not erupt again. WebInactive Volcanoes in the Philippines Presently, there are over 300 inactive volcanoes in the country.
